diff --git a/ci/drone.yml b/ci/drone.yml index 04bbf2d..43f158a 100644 --- a/ci/drone.yml +++ b/ci/drone.yml @@ -29,7 +29,25 @@ steps: when: event: [ push, tag ] branch: [ main ] - + + - name: Remove old dev.ad5001.eu + image: appleboy/drone-ssh + settings: + host: + from_secret: SSH_HOST + username: + from_secret: SSH_USERNAME + password: + from_secret: SSH_PASSWORD + envs: + - DEV_WWW_PATH + script: + - cd "$DEV_WWW_PATH" + - rm -rf * + when: + event: [ push, tag ] + branch: [ main ] + - name: Deploy dev.ad5001.eu image: appleboy/drone-scp settings: @@ -54,6 +72,24 @@ steps: event: [ push, tag ] branch: [ prod ] + - name: Remove old ad5001.eu + image: appleboy/drone-ssh + settings: + host: + from_secret: SSH_HOST + username: + from_secret: SSH_USERNAME + password: + from_secret: SSH_PASSWORD + envs: + - DEV_WWW_PATH + script: + - cd "$DEV_WWW_PATH" + - rm -rf * + when: + event: [ push, tag ] + branch: [ prod ] + - name: Deploy ad5001.eu image: appleboy/drone-scp settings: